WOONSOCKET, RI — A man Woonsocket police said was wanted for purposefully hitting another with his car was arrested Tuesday night in Pawtucket.

Police said they now have Andrew Martin, 37, in custody, who struck Michael Lefebvre, 31, with his car, Monday on East School Street. A few days later, Lefebvre died at the hospital, so Martin will be charged with murder, felony assault and battery, assault with intent to commit specified felonies, driving to endanger resulting in death, and driving without a license.

According to police, the two men were at odds over domestic relationships.

Martin is scheduled to appear in Sixth District Court on Wednesday.
